What is the difference between tri and triathlon?

Tri is simply an informal, shortened form of triathlon, used casually among athletes and fans, while triathlon is the full, formal name of the multi-sport race combining swimming, cycling, and running. The shortened form is common in spoken or informal written contexts, such as training logs or casual conversation.

Can 'tri' also mean triangle?

Yes, tri is also an informal short form of triangle, so its meaning depends heavily on context, such as sports talk versus geometry or music discussion. Readers typically rely on surrounding words to determine whether tri refers to the race or the shape.

Is 'tri' appropriate to use in formal writing?

No, because tri is labeled informal, it is better suited to casual speech or writing, such as conversations among athletes, rather than formal documents, which should use the full words triathlon or triangle instead.
